Russian player of the Washington Capitals hockey club of the National Hockey League (NHL) Alexander Ovechkin got into the database of the extremist Ukrainian website "Mirotvorets".

According to the portal, by participating in international competitions, the athlete allegedly "bleached the reputation of Russia." In addition, the athlete is accused of allegedly "justifying aggression against Ukraine" among a foreign audience.

The Mirotvorets website publishes the data of people who allegedly threaten the national security of Ukraine.

Earlier, on February 20, Russian stylist and singer Sergey Zverev appeared on the lists of the Ukrainian website "Mirotvorets". As indicated on the resource, the reason was the expression of support for the special military operation (SVO) of Russia.

The Mirotvorets website, created in 2014, is a public registry of personal data of journalists, artists, politicians and other media personalities from different countries who allegedly threaten the national security of Ukraine.
